Dell Latitude XT3 Specifications

General IconGeneral
MemoryUp to 8GB DDR3
GraphicsIntel HD Graphics 3000
Operating SystemWindows 7 Professional
WirelessWi-Fi 802.11 a/b/g/n, Bluetooth 3.0
ProcessorIntel Core i5 or i7
Display13.3-inch HD (1366 x 768)
StorageUp to 320GB HDD
Battery6-cell
TouchscreenYes
PortsUSB 2.0, HDMI, VGA, RJ-45
WebcamYes
